The porch light lens on my coach is getting fairly yellow with age. I am also afraid it will fall out and be lost at some point. 

Bair, do you or anyone else know where we can find a replacement lens?

The light fixture was supplied by Delco Products and it was fixture #926 with the lens being 926-103.  If we knew where else the fixture was used or originally designed for it would help us find a source.

Other coaches or trailers or applications that may have used this same fixture?

It appears that this light was added at coach #300 and so it would be from that number and up.

The porch light and shower light lens is available from Bob Hurley RV as stock number 18-2281.

Here is the link: https://bob-hurley-rv.myshopify.com/products/18-2281

When I attempted to order it online, the system wanted to charge me an excessive amount for shipping. I would call at 918-947-8888, ext. 2021 and speak with Jon Hinkle. Advise him that you are concerned about shipping cost and see what he can do.

I have replaced both of my lenses and also have a spare. It fits correctly.

They used the same light on Airstream trailers. You can find replacements at Airstream parts places on the web. Early coaches don't have a light in the shower George
